Sorts Of Sedation Options
When it pertains to choosing the ideal sedation choice for your dental procedure, you'll find a number of techniques customized to different needs and preferences. The most typical types are laughing gas, oral sedation, and IV sedation.
Laughing gas, additionally referred to as chuckling gas, is a prominent option for numerous clients. It's breathed in with a mask, giving a soothing effect while permitting you to stay conscious and receptive. The impacts subside promptly, so you can drive yourself home afterward.

IV sedation provides much deeper leisure and enables your dental professional to change the sedation level during the procedure. This technique is suitable for longer or more complicated therapies. You'll likely remain in a semi-conscious state and will certainly need a person to drive you home afterward.
Each option has its benefits, so discussing your choices and interest in your dentist will certainly help you make the best choice for your requirements.
Preparing for Your Visit
Getting ready for your oral consultation includes a couple of vital actions to make sure a smooth experience. Initially, verify your visit time and day. It's important to show up on schedule to stay clear of any type of delays.
Next, discuss any kind of drugs you're currently taking with your dentist beforehand. This consists of non-prescription medicines and supplements, as they may affect your sedation choices.
If you're having sedation dentistry, your dental professional will likely provide certain guidelines. You might need to avoid eating or consuming alcohol for a specific period before your visit. Comply with these standards closely to ensure your safety and security.
Schedule a person to accompany you on the day of your visit, specifically if you'll be getting sedation. You will not have the ability to drive later, so having actually a relied on buddy or member of the family to aid you is vital.
Last but not least, prepare any type of questions you have in breakthrough. This is your chance to clarify any kind of worries about the treatment, sedation choices, or healing.
